What economic factors influence CAD vs USD value?

Exchange rates fluctuate based on trade balances, interest rates, and inflation levels in both Canada and the United States. A stronger Canadian economy with low inflation and rising interest rates can boost the CAD, making it more valuable against the USD.
Trade relations also play a crucial role. Canada’s exports, particularly in natural resources like oil and lumber, directly affect the CAD. High demand for Canadian goods strengthens the CAD, while a decrease in exports can weaken it. Similarly, changes in US economic performance can impact the USD, indirectly influencing CAD/USD rates.

When sending money internationally, one of the key factors to consider is the exchange rate. If you are using PayPal to convert 5 CAD (Canadian Dollars) to USD (United States Dollars), the amount you will receive depends on PayPal's exchange rate and any applicable fees. PayPal typically charges a margin on the exchange rate, which is higher than the mid-market rate you may see on financial platforms.
For example, if PayPal offers an exchange rate of 1 CAD = 0.74 USD, converting 5 CAD would give you approximately 3.70 USD. However, this exchange rate is subject to change, so it’s important to check the current rate before making any transactions.
In addition to the exchange rate, PayPal may charge a foreign transaction fee, which could reduce the total amount you receive. These fees are often a percentage of the transaction amount.
